The secret weapons shouldn’t really have been any secret at all. Munster were always going to bounce back against the Isuzu Southern Kings – and I picked them as my team defence for the week – but the emphatic nature with which they dispatched the South Africans meant that JJ Hanrahan had an arm chair ride and was able to rack up some kicking points, including six conversions, in a massive win. I also went for Shane Daly. Only 6.8% of our fantasy players chose him and he’s been bubbling away nicely with his performances of late. Two second-half tries and 87 metres in the game will do thank you very much. But you could have had any number of Munster performers in your team with the likes of Arno Botha with three tries and full-back Mike Haley, the top metre maker for the round, notching up 115 metres, three offloads and six defenders beaten. Munster travel to Zebre in Round 12 in what should be an entertaining game. If the weather holds and with both teams playing a good brand of rugby, you would be wise to pick players from these two sides as I feel there may well be a few line breaks and tries.
